Subject: [PATCH v3 0/2] rockchip rk3399 port initialization fixes
Date: Fri, 12 Apr 2024 11:37:19 +0900 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240412023721.1049303-1-dlemoal@kernel.org> (raw)
A couple of patches to have the rockchip rk3399 host controller port
initialization follow the PCI specifications around PERST# signal timing
handling.
Changes from v2:
- Use PCIE_T_PVPERL_MS macro in patch 1 (and remove useless comments).
- Split second msleep() addition into patch 2 as suggested by Bjorn.
Changes from v1:
- Add more specification details to the commit message.
- Add missing msleep(100) after PERST# is deasserted.
Damien Le Moal (2):
PCI: rockchip-host: Fix rockchip_pcie_host_init_port() PERST# handling
PCI: rockchip-host: Wait 100ms after reset before starting configuration
drivers/pci/controller/pcie-rockchip-host.c | 3 +++
drivers/pci/pci.h | 7 +++++++
2 files changed, 10 insertions(+)
